Output e9dbb64d726c86eb0c6dd799cf55a07f27531afacedb30f77060c029d6810c92:6

value
495953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5208531bd3fea91f9fef402e7e418f32e1f641ce OP_EQUAL
address
39AmJgQUn5JNhV5WufwmqW6pdv62E3DQ8z
transaction
e9dbb64d726c86eb0c6dd799cf55a07f27531afacedb30f77060c029d6810c92
confirmations
267892
spent
true